  • Patent number: 5741954
    Abstract: This invention relates to a process for the preparation of m-alkylphenols, particularly of 3-ethylphenol, from the mixture of alkylbenzenesulfonic acid isomers by selective desulfonation, removal of formed alkylbenzene and caustic fusion. In the present invention the inventive desulfonation is accomplished by addition of steam to the mixture of sulfonic acid in an excess in relation to the amount of evaporable water, simultaneously maintaining the temperature of the mixture above 160.degree. C. until the desired purity of isomers is obtained, and until the content of the sulfuric acid in the mixture is decreased below 40%.

  • Patent number: 5684183
    Abstract: The invention is related to a method for preparing 4-alkyl-2-hydroxy-3,5-dichlorobenzene sulphonic acids by sulphonating 4-chloro-3-alkylphenol and by chlorinating 4-alkyl-2-hydroxy-5-chlorobenzene sulphonic acid present in an acidic reaction mixture. According to the invention, chlorination is carried out by adding, to the acidic reaction mixture, salts of hypochlorous and/or chloric acids and, when needed, hydrochloric acid or its salt.

  • Patent number: 5114701
    Abstract: The invention concerns a method for producing hydrogen peroxide using a process based on anthraquinone derivatives. According to the invention the solvent system of the working solution in said process contains carbamate having a general formula ##STR1## where groups R.sup.1 and R.sup.2, which can be the same or different ones, are a hydrogen atom or a hydrocarbon group and R.sup.3 is a hydrocarbon group,whereby the groups R.sup.1, R.sup.2 and R.sup.3 can optionally be part of a cyclic structure and/or substituted by groups which are inert to the process.

  • Patent number: 4732708
    Abstract: The invention relates to a method for converting biopolyesters consisting of straight-chain hydroxyacid monomers containing 10 to 40 carbon atoms, such as suberin and cutin, into a plain mixture of organic acids and their salts containing only a few main components. The depolymerization is carried out according to the invention by oxidizing either with a strong oxidizer or by dehydrating oxidation with strong alkali at elevated temperature.
